Pros

Flex hours. Many free meals. Friendly environment

Cons

Their technology is so outdated it dates back to the 1980's and the new technologies they are trying to bring along are not any newer. Their competitors are 10 or more years ahead. Believe it or not they still use modems to communicate with computers. It is a very political place. Do work here if you are a good politician. Don't work here if you want your work to be valued for what is worth. Many senior managers are very arrogant, they think they know everything and don't want to hear bad news. They get offended very quickly Yearly raises suck. If you meet your job's expectations the most you are going to get is a 2% raise. That is typical. In other words with inflation running at 3-4% every year you are worst off every year. An employee with 7 or more years is better off finding a job somewhere else in order to catch up with his/her salary. Don't blame Taco Bell. To sell meals for 89 cents they need to cut corners.

Pros

Free beverages. . . . .

Cons

limited pay increase (worked there for over a year and only received a 15 cents raise after 12 months) unreasonable hours no room for schedule changes (as a new member of the company my schedule was very flexible, but as I got further into the company and learned more positions aside from cashier, it became difficult to change schedule or request time off) crazy customers (after over a year of working there I have dealt with the most difficult, demanding, and disrespectful customers) be prepared to be verbally abused by upset customers (as a cashier the anger will typically be let out on you) absolutely no employee recognition not the place for a teenager to work (worked with no one near my age) in my area the majority of employees were hispanic and spoke little english, made it incredibly difficult to communicate as a team cleaning bathrooms (at taco bell...enough said) Promotions are available however raises are not (was promoted to team member trainer, took on all of the extra responsibilities, only received a 15 cent raise) Management was obsessed with conserving hours so had minimal employees working at all times, this became incredibly difficult to deal with during busy times
